通过 REST 服务从数据库中添加多个对象的方法可以使用 HTTP 的 POST 请求来实现。具体步骤如下:
- 创建一个 RESTful API 接口,用于接收客户端的请求并处理添加对象的逻辑。
- 在客户端发送 POST 请求时,将要添加的对象数据作为请求的 payload 发送给服务器。
- 服务器端接收到请求后,解析 payload 中的数据,并将其存储到数据库中。
- 添加对象的方法可以使用数据库操作语言(如 SQL)来执行插入操作,将对象数据插入到相应的数据库表中。
- 在添加对象的过程中,可以进行数据校验和验证,确保数据的完整性和准确性。
- 添加对象成功后,服务器端可以返回相应的成功状态码(如 200 OK)和消息给客户端,表示添加操作已完成。
- 如果添加对象失败,服务器端可以返回相应的错误状态码(如 400 Bad Request)和错误消息给客户端,指示添加操作失败的原因。
这种方法适用于需要批量添加对象的场景,例如批量注册用户、批量上传文件等。在实际应用中,可以根据具体需求进行优化和改进,例如使用事务来确保数据的一致性,使用分布式数据库来提高性能和可扩展性等。
腾讯云提供了丰富的云计算产品和服务,可以用于支持上述方法的实现。其中,推荐使用的产品包括:
- 腾讯云云服务器(ECS):提供可扩展的虚拟服务器实例,用于部署和运行后端服务。
产品介绍链接:https://cloud.tencent.com/product/cvm
- 腾讯云数据库(TencentDB):提供高性能、可扩展的数据库服务,支持多种数据库引擎(如 MySQL、Redis 等)。
产品介绍链接:https://cloud.tencent.com/product/cdb
- 腾讯云API网关(API Gateway):提供灵活、可扩展的 API 管理和调度服务,用于构建和管理 RESTful API 接口。
产品介绍链接:https://cloud.tencent.com/product/apigateway
以上是一个简单的答案示例,根据具体情况和需求,可以进一步完善和补充答案内容。